2003
Main article: ''Yu-Gi-Oh! World Championship 2003'' prize cards
(Madison Square Garden, New York City) August 10
2004
Main article: ''Yu-Gi-Oh! World Championship 2004'' prize cards
(Los Angeles) July 25
2005
Main article: ''Yu-Gi-Oh! World Championship 2005'' prize cards
(Differ Ariake Arena, Tokyo) August 7
2006
Main article: ''Yu-Gi-Oh! World Championship 2006'' prize cards
(Tokyo) August 5–6
- WCPS-EN601 Testament of the Arcane Lords
- WCPS-EN602 Armament of the Lethal Lords
- WCPS-AE603 Seiyaryu
2007
Main article: ''Yu-Gi-Oh! World Championship 2007'' prize cards
(San Diego Convention Center, San Diego) July 28–29
- WCPS-EN700 Get Your Game On!
- WCPS-EN701 Chimaera, the Master of Beasts
- WCPS-EN702 Emperor of Lightning
- WCPS-AE703 Testament of the Arcane Lords
2008
Main article: ''Yu-Gi-Oh! World Championship 2008'' prize cards
(Berlin) August 9–10
- WCPS-EN801 Tyr, the Vanquishing Warlord
- WCPS-EN802 Lorelei, the Symphonic Arsenal
- WCPS-AE803 Chimaera, the Master of Beasts
2009
Main article: ''Yu-Gi-Oh! World Championship 2009'' prize cards
(Tokyo) August 8–9
- WCPS-EN901 Aggiba, the Malevolent Sh'nn S'yo
- WCPS-EN902 Skuna, the Leonine Rakan
- WCPS-AE903 Tyr, the Vanquishing Warlord
2010
Main article: ''Yu-Gi-Oh! World Championship 2010'' prize cards
(Long Beach Convention Center, Long Beach) August 14–15
- 2010-EN001 Stardust Divinity
- 2010-EN002 Grizzly, the Red Star Beast
- 2010-AE003 Aggiba, the Malevolent Sh'nn S'yo
2011
Main article: ''Yu-Gi-Oh! World Championship 2011'' prize cards
(Amsterdam) August 13–14
- 2011-EN001 King Landia the Goldfang
- 2011-EN002 Queen Nereia the Silvercrown
- 2011-AE003 Stardust Divinity
2012
Main article: ''Yu-Gi-Oh! World Championship 2012'' prize cards
(Tokyo) August 11–12
- 2012-EN001 Legendary Dragon of White
- 2012-EN002 Legendary Magician of Dark
- 2012-AE003 King Landia the Goldfang
- 2012-JP004 Token (World Championship 2012)
2013
Main article: ''Yu-Gi-Oh! World Championship 2013'' prize cards
(Las Vegas) August 10–11
- 2013-EN001 Grandopolis, The Eternal Golden City
- 2013-EN002 E☆HERO Pit Boss
- 2013-AE003 Legendary Dragon of White
2014
Main article: ''Yu-Gi-Oh! World Championship 2014'' prize cards
(Palacongressi di Rimini, Rimini) August 9–10
- 2014-EN001 The Twin Kings, Founders of the Empire
- 2014-EN002 Leonardo's Silver Skyship
- 2014-AE003 Grandopolis, The Eternal Golden City
2015
Main article: ''Yu-Gi-Oh! World Championship 2015'' prize cards
(Kyoto) August 15–16
- 2015-EN001 Kuzunoha, the Onmyojin
- 2015-EN002 Sakyo, Swordmaster of the Far East
- 2015-EN003 The Twin Kings, Founders of the Empire
2016
Main article: ''Yu-Gi-Oh! World Championship 2016'' prize cards
(Florida) August 20–21
2017
Main article: ''Yu-Gi-Oh! World Championship 2017'' prize cards
(Tokyo) August 13-14
2018
Main article: ''Yu-Gi-Oh! World Championship 2018'' prize cards
(Chiba) August 4-5
2019
Main article: ''Yu-Gi-Oh! World Championship 2019'' prize cards
(Berlin) August 10-11
